Police Scanner

Police Scanner comprises live audio streams that feature police scanners, fire alarms, wildfire information, maps, railroad radios, marine, aircraft, emergency, news, and amateur radio. The app keeps listeners updated with the latest news. You can filter scanners by location to find nearby local audio feeds or switch locations to discover what’s going on in other regions. Enable notifications, receive alerts, and track major events, activity, breaking news, traffic, and emergencies. The free version is ad-supported, but you can remove the ads with the Pro version for $10 per month or $30 per year.

PoliceScanner+

This app lets you listen to live audio from police and fire scanners all over the world. You can select from thousands of feeds, find the current top 100 feeds, search for your favorites, listen in the background, and even locate your feed on the map. The premium version is $5, and a yearly subscription costs $40.

Police Scanner

This highly rated free Android scanner lets you listen in on live audio from over 7,000 police radio scanners, fire scanners, and amateur radio repeaters worldwide, mostly in English-language nations. The app lets you view the top 25 most popular police scanner radio stations, save your favorites, and tune into air traffic, rail, marina, weather, and emergency radio stations.

Scanner Radio

Scanner Radio lets you browse a variety of channels worldwide, view the top 50 scanners and recently added scanners, and target your specific location. You can also find public safety, air traffic, and marine scanners with the app. You can receive notifications when major events or emergencies take place, and it supports Android Auto. The $3 pro version removes ads, includes push notifications, and offers the ability to record audio. You also have the choice to only remove ads without new features for $2. Updated versions let you add three widgets to your home screen so you can quickly jump to your favorite feed or observe breaking news in real time. To add a widget, long-press on your home screen and tap + and scroll down to Scanner Radio.

5-0 Radio Police Scanner is a top-rated iOS police scanner app, providing global coverage of Fire, EMS, and Police feeds. Users can even create their own custom feeds, as well as browse lists of broadcasts by country. The Feeds with Active Alerts system alerts users of noteworthy events in their newsfeeds. This allows you to consistently check your feed even while the app is still running in the background, letting you browse through your social media accounts or text messages without missing essential broadcasts. The app is free, but for $5 you can ditch the ads.

Citizen

While not precisely a police scanner, Citizen serves many of the same functions a classic scanner does, and much more. Use this safety app to get real-time safety alerts, live video of incidents, updates on natural disasters or protests, and know if your loved ones are near a dangerous incident. Citizen can notify you of a crime in progress, even before the police respond. You can also subscribe to 24/7 access to a trained Protect Agent to assist you whenever you feel unsafe. This person can discreetly help, silently monitor your live location and audio, alert other users, call 911, monitor heart rate through your Apple Watch, and more.
